Sat 899140905816339

decimal
179828.905816339
degree
0°179828′404″905816339‴
percentile
42.816233657399735%
name
hmdlvxplxzy
cycle
0
epoch
0
period
89
block
179828
offset
905816339
timestamp
rarity
common
inscriptions
location
56370da78280640d4aa92d48db143748400e992fe9b54f50f72cebc6a53b378c:0:1443205167
address
12VuUfQHTGqWDvBzm8TBad1mZBm4hjGEzN